Why Brunch is Becoming Popular in Ohio?OHIO - Ohio, the "Heart of It All," has seen a dramatic shift in its weekend culture over the last few years. While the state has always loved a hearty breakfast, the modern Ohio brunch is a different beast entirely—blending Midwestern hospitality with craft brewery culture, global influences, and a serious passion for local ingredients.

Pro Traveler's Tips:

  1. The "Waitlist" Apps: Popular Ohio spots like HangOverEasy and Kitchen Social allow you to join the waitlist virtually. Use this to your advantage to avoid standing in the cold!
  2. Quiet Zone Days: In college towns like Columbus and Athens, home-game Saturdays are chaotic. If you want a peaceful brunch, aim for Sunday morning or a non-game day.
  3. Bakery First: Many Ohio brunch spots started as bakeries. If there is a display case, buy a pastry for the road—they are often the highlight of the meal.
